| 31 | * Note about using the Xan DPCM decoder: Xan DPCM is used in AVI files |
| 32 | * found in the Wing Commander IV computer game. These AVI files contain |
| 33 | * WAVEFORMAT headers which report the audio format as 0x01: raw PCM. |
| 34 | * Clearly incorrect. To detect Xan DPCM, you will probably have to |
| 35 | * special-case your AVI demuxer to use Xan DPCM if the file uses 'Xxan' |
| 36 | * (Xan video) for its video codec. Alternately, such AVI files also contain |
| 37 | * the fourcc 'Axan' in the 'auds' chunk of the AVI header. |
